Title: "The Enchanted Village and the Wealth of Kindness"
Once upon a time, in a far-off land, there was a small, poor village named Aylesbury. The villagers were simple folk, living off the land and barely making ends meet. Despite their hardships, they were kind-hearted and shared whatever little they had with each other.
In Aylesbury, there was a unique tradition. The villagers believed that every animal had a spirit and deserved respect and kindness. They would share their meals with the animals, provide them shelter during harsh weather, and nurse them back to health when they were sick.
One day, a terrible drought hit the village. The crops failed, and the villagers were left with no food or water. Desperate and hungry, they turned to the animals for help. They asked the animals to search for food and water, promising to share whatever they found.
The animals, remembering the kindness of the villagers, agreed to help. The birds flew high and wide, the rabbits dug deep into the earth, and the deer ventured into the dense forest. After days of searching, they returned with seeds, fruits, and a map to a hidden spring.
The villagers were overjoyed. They planted the seeds, harvested the fruits, and fetched water from the spring. With the help of the animals, they were able to survive the drought.
But the story doesn't end here. The seeds that the animals had brought were no ordinary seeds. They were seeds from the Enchanted Forest, and when they grew, they bore golden fruits. The villagers sold these golden fruits in the neighboring towns and soon, Aylesbury was no longer a poor village.
The villagers thanked the animals for their help and promised to always share their wealth with them. They built shelters for the animals, fed them the finest food, and cared for them like family.
The story of Aylesbury spread far and wide, inspiring young and old. It taught everyone that kindness, respect, and unity can turn a poor village into a prosperous one. And that every act of kindness, no matter how small, can bring about a world of change.
And so, Aylesbury thrived, a shining example of harmony between humans and animals, a beacon of hope in a world that often forgot the wealth of kindness. The villagers and the animals lived happily ever after, their hearts rich with love and their lives filled with joy.
